Imagine two regular updates.

First you update mariadb-server package. %post is smart and it will condrestart 
the mariadb service. However...

Next day you update "pam" package which provides /usr/lib64/libpam.so.0 which 
is used by mariadb service.
Unless you restart your computer your mariadb server will continue to use old 
(and maybe insecure) libpam.so.
Or unless you use dnf-plugins-extras-tracer:
